Output 8ec7a29fa332d77fdc074e2aeebea947f80cc42e70a357f70291b02487c5f9df:0

value
7008604
script pubkey
OP_0 OP_PUSHBYTES_32 3398d4c211524068724ee40af9cc626d8a348cb4a3c2d17680f63d91d98d8f93
address
bc1qxwvdfss32fqxsujwus90nnrzdk9rfr9550pdza5q7c7erkvd37fseqzkq8
transaction
8ec7a29fa332d77fdc074e2aeebea947f80cc42e70a357f70291b02487c5f9df
confirmations
106646
spent
true